The name Challenger, in honor of the seven astronauts who died in the space shuttle tragedy last year, was selected Tuesday for the new Mira Mesa junior high school scheduled to open in September.

The San Diego Board of Education voted unanimously for the name, which is an exception to the general district policy of naming schools after either prominent civic individuals or a school’s geographic location.

The junior high at Parkdale Place and Winterwood Lane will open in temporary facilities in September for an estimated 900 seventh-graders. A permanent school is scheduled for completion by 1990, with 1,600 seventh- and eighth-graders.
